Question

For Oat 1 atm and 298 K, what fraction of molecules has a speed between 200. and 300. m/sec?  What is this fraction if the gas temperature is 500K? 

For O2 at 1 atm and 298 K, what fraction of molecules has a speed that is greater than vmp? vave? vrms?

 

Use a spread sheet to calculate these values.  For the fraction between 200 and 300, calculate two ways, just using the values at 200 and 300 and then by using the values from 200, 201, 202 ….298, 299, 300.  Compare these answers.

 

For the fraction of molecules with a speed that is greater than vmp, vave, and vrms use the size of interval that you feel is appropriate.  Compare these fractions.
